Field Hockey Shuts Out Hartwick On Senior Day

PITTSFORD, N.Y. – The St. John Fisher College field hockey team capped of its regular season schedule with an Empire 8 Conference victory on Senior Day over Hartwick College by a score of 3-0. With the win the Cardinals secure the #2 seed in next week's Empire 8 Conference Championship. Fisher improves to 15-3 overall and 6-1 in the Empire 8, while the Hawks fall to 11-7 and 4-4 in the Empire 8.

Lauren Fazio put the Cardinals on the board first at the 26:37 minute mark of the first half as she took a pass from Danila Casseri and blasted a shot past the goalkeeper for her 8th goal of the season. Fisher outshot Hartwick 10-1 in the first half and brought a 1-0 lead into halftime.

Reghan Amoroso tallied the second goal for the Cardinals as she deflected a shot from Bre Socker in front of the cage at the 44:13 mark for her 5th goal of the season.

With eight minutes remaining in the second half, Jess Snyder tallied her 4th of the season off a feed from Emily Markarian to put the Cardinals up 3-0. Goalkeeper Ashley Maynard was credited to win and improved her record to 15-3, as well as completing her eighth shutout of the season.

The Cardinals return to action at 2:30 p.m. on Friday as they travel to Washington and Jefferson College to play part in the Empire 8 Championship.
